Moving from Omaha to Decatur shifts your BEA Regional Price Parity from 91.9 to 88.4 (100 = US average), so a Omaha salary needs to be multiplied by 0.96 to hold the same purchasing power in Decatur. On rent, HUD Fair Market Rent for a 2-bedroom goes from $1,368/month in Omaha to $1,063/month in Decatur - a lower monthly bill of $305, or $3,660/year. That rent delta alone is often the single biggest line item when relocating.

Wages tell the other half. BLS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ics report a median salary of $70,611 in Omaha versus $65,802 in Decatur - a raw gap of $4,809 lower. The Decatur labor market has 36,440 tracked jobs against 488,200 in Omaha, shaping how easy it is to find a comparable role. Combine that with the cost-of-living shift above and you get the real purchasing-power delta, sometimes a "higher salary" is actually a pay cut once rent and RPP are applied.

Safety, schools, and childcare round out the move. FBI UCR violent crime rates near Omaha and Decatur are 217 and 277 per 100,000 (state-level). NCES student-teacher ratios run 13.5:1 at origin versus 14:1 at destination. DOL center-based infant care costs $9,863/year in Omaha versus $12,257/year in Decatur. Our composite verdict - Less Favorable - weighs all seven federal sources; the dimension table below lets you override that with your personal priorities.
